About the Journal

Human Communication & Technology is an international and interdisciplinary peer-reviewed journal that publishes the highest quality original research on the intersection of human communication and technology. HCT aspires to be the leading journal at this intersection.

Vol. 3 No. 2 (2023): Special Issue on Developing & Communicating Identity via Technology

Identity plays a fundamental role in social and personal communication, and technologies serve as important venues for identity development, refinement, and display. Dr. Erin Sumner (Trinity University) and Dr. Andrew High (Penn State University) edited this special issue of Human Communication & Technology.
